Debate of the Decade: RCTs in the Era of Precision Oncology
How do you design clinical trials in the era of precision oncology? Are prospective randomized controlled trials necessary anymore? Drs. Ray Kurzrock, Vivek Subbiah, and Christopher Booth drop the gloves and debate these questions - beginning with the definition of “precision oncology,” what phase the trials should be when initially designing, and whether accelerated approval and surrogate endpoints are truly helping patients in the precision oncology era. The group also analyzes specific examples of approved drugs and whether randomized controlled trials were and would have been good ideas prior to approval.

Integrating APPs Into Oncology Care
To better understand the role and importance of Advanced Practice Providers in oncology care, Chadi hosts Sarah Wyman, MSN, ACNP-BC, and Katie Simon, MMSc, PA-C, both co-leads of the APPs on the inpatient malignant hematology services team at Emory University Winship Cancer Institute. They begin by explaining the similar training and skill sets of NPs and PAs, the history of these positions over the past 25 years, and the day-to-day responsibilities for inpatient APPs. Then, they share how discharge planning is handled, the level of autonomy granted to APPs in decision making and test ordering, how doctors relate to APPs in the clinic (and whether there is friction), and their role in initiating end-of-life discussions, among so much more.

Cytogenetics and Cancer Care With Linda Baughn and Yassmine Akkari
In the world of whole-genome sequencing, do we really need cytogenetics anymore? To answer this question, Chadi brings on two cytogeneticists: Linda Baughn, PhD, and Yassmine Akkari, PhD. They begin by describing their unique career paths to becoming cytogeneticists, their day-to-day responsibilities, and what tests they perform and on what specimens. They then simplify the commonly used assays in their labs, how cytogenetic techniques are evolving (rather than dying), what whole genome sequencing looks like in the future, and topics that cytogeneticists disagree on, among other discussion points.

For Blood and Money: A Biotech Story
Nathan Vardi, managing editor at MarketWatch, and author of the new book “For Blood and Money: Billionaires, Biotech, and the Quest for a Blockbuster Drug,” is the guest of honor on today’s show. Nathan divulges on what happened behind closed doors for the creation of BTK inhibitors. Everything at the intersection of Wall Street, investigators, doctors, regulatory agencies, investors, and VC is detailed. He begins by explaining the inspiration to cover this story and how willing individuals were to speak on the record, describes in detail a few of the nuances of and feelings toward specific characters, provides examples of the role that luck plays in cancer drug development, and opines on the FDA’s challenge of approving the right drugs for market, among many other fascinating topics.
